Van Wersch v. Department of Health and Human Services, 100 FMSR 7005, 197 F.3d 1144 (Fed. Cir. 1999), and McCormick v. Department of the Air Force, 102 LRP 24759, 307 F.3d 1339 (Fed. Cir. 2002), pointed out a contradiction between 5 USC 7511(a)(1) and the Office of Personnel Management's regulations at 5 CFR Part 752 over how to determine whether probationary requirements have been met. In 2008, OPM amended its regulations to address the contradiction.

The following points summarize the effects of these two key decisions on the handling of probationary employees.
